58 is the difference of Janelle's height and 24.
abruzzese [7]

Answer:

Janelle's height is 82 units.

Step-by-step explanation:

Let j represent Janelle's height.

It is mentioned that, 58 is the difference between Janelle's height and 24.

Mathematically, we can write it as :

j-24 = 58

We can solve it as follows :

Adding 24 both sides,

j-24+24 = 58+24

j = 82

Hence, Janelle's height is 82 units.
